I would recommend you register on consultancy sites like GLG. Occasionally you’ll see opportunities on the subject of art pipelines. Not often, but it’s something to supplement your income, and oddly provides you with confidence in that it tests your knowledge in the way you answer client questions.
Decent rates offered for information you hold and seldom share.
Also look at Tegus and Guidepoint who are similar. Again - not something that will provide regular work, but does keep the information fresh in your mind. Set a good rate for yourself too, making it worth your while as most calls are 30mins to an hour, and the information and experience you've accumulated during your career, is gold to an investment group or even a company who desperately need the insight.
